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77 27724260226 95750454119 6470282
31428930403 32981108
31428930403 32981108
58 713876 488 479300510 74117
All about undefined
Interested in learning more?
31428930403 32981108
58 713876 488 479300510 74117
See more
3382673368 916180 41487
71932880889 837 153216
See more
06998505586 98670
3223 95511 030
See more